|
愛特梅爾MPCF-II技術將基於ARM處理器的客製化SoC帶入產量達一萬單位的應用領域,而且不需要授權費用/ b. Y& R. u3 p* |* x9 q
' {8 t/ @- `* j c CAP7L可客製化微控制器的一次性支出為7.5萬美元能夠降低入門級市場產品的成本 ( o* c \- b9 U: \
+ u1 l3 ~2 y- m3 g( b愛特梅爾公司 (Atmel® Corporation)推出CAP7L可客製化微控制器,可讓無晶圓廠(fabless) 的半導體公司以縮短至12周的交貨週期、僅為7.5萬美元的一次性支出 (NRE) 及低至5美元的單位成本,且不需要取得ARM公司的單獨許可,便可實現建基於ARM7™ 處理器的系統單晶片
- C* H i. o9 x(systems-on-chip, SoC)。( Z3 O! m- X0 E: m2 m
! o: L7 \9 T. r, C9 A E! X2 l
CAP7L可提供目前最低的NRE成本,為產量為一萬單位的專案提供良好的經濟效益,完全攤銷後的單位成本為17美元;而對於產量為五萬個單位的專案,攤銷後的單位成本僅為7美元,並已將NRE和IP的費用包括在內了。
3 l3 _5 O1 P- d' B, t8 c2 B
9 V. [: `: ` _1 i" g% CAT91CAP7L 器件是標準微控制器產品,具有多達20萬閘金屬可程式單元结構(Metal Programmable Cell Fabric, MPCF),可用於實現專有的客製化 IP、硬體加速器、附加處理器內核或獨特的周邊集,以產生客製化的SoC。: U& Y3 n; I, m5 \8 r6 I: F
+ z8 i: ?4 P. w# c使用愛特梅爾第二代金屬可程式單元結構技術MPCF-II,可將一次性支出降到7.5萬美元。於2007年發佈的MPCF技術能夠讓基於單元的ASIC器件,以較ASIC平臺更低成本和更快的交貨週期達到很高的矽效率。最初的方案使用觸點、六層金屬,以及五個通孔層(via layer),可用於MP庫單元的配置和互連。而全新的MPCF-II技術則具有專為晶片配置和路由而設計的全新VP(Via Programmable)單元庫,僅使用三層金屬和三個通孔層,從而將光罩數量從12個減少至6個,並省去達 50%的NRE成本。8 l1 T- R2 ?% q: n3 Y4 n# V
; Z8 m3 `+ }4 O/ {1 t; N$ U# t" T
金屬可程式 (metal programmable, MP)模組 (block) 約占CAP7L晶片面積之15%,其餘85% 的晶片面積是預定義的 (pre-defined),包括了一個ARM7處理器和4層AMBA®AHB™匯流排和22個通道周邊DMA控制器、USB設備、 SPI的主和從器件、兩個USART、三個16位元定時計數器、一個8通道/10位元類比數位轉換器、160KB SRAM,以及一個包括中斷、功率控制和監控功能的全功能系統控制器。為了確保MP模組中客製化功能和晶片其餘部分之間有充分的通信,MP模組具備有兩個AMBA AHB主器件 (master) 和兩個AMBA AHB從器件 (slave)、十四個AMBA先進周邊匯流排(APB™)從器件,以及可通過硬體選擇來分享I/O的32位元可程式I/O。另外,還有一個片上專有中斷控制器,提供多達13個經編碼的中斷和兩個附加的未經編碼的中斷,可用於DMA傳送。
4 y, b( {3 k) R. D2 N9 y/ [& L9 r, ]
4 t1 W( [/ i6 |% Y9 \! j, S
" f$ C! Q" L5 j, u8 mCAP7L可以為那些開發具有差異性、基於ARM處理器的系統設計之大型OEM客戶及為微控器市場帶來新IP的創新無晶圓廠公司,帶來較低成本的解決方案。。MPCF II技術能夠在NRE費用有限的謹慎經濟狀況下,實現具有豐富功能的ARM7處理器設計,這是激勵小型設計團隊和工程技術預算有限的設計發展和成長的理想選擇。# g* |& | r, a2 c
: j, E( n: M1 h" K {/ d, f
愛特梅爾公司CAP™產品市場總監Jay Johnson表示:“無晶圓廠半導體公司在實施新設計時,常常會陷入一種左右為難的處境,因為全客製化ASIC所需的10萬美元NRE費用和以百萬單位計的最少訂購量常常使得設計人員卻步, 尤其是在市場接受度不確定的情況下,採用全客製化ASIC的做法很不實際。雖然他們也可以採用量小、快速交貨的ASIC,但其單位成本卻往往達到數百美元。而且在任何一種情況下,它們可能都需要向ARM 購買其IP許可。”% C) x2 T1 j, q( I; i. a, _! N) s
! g) G7 a/ F+ k
Johnson進一步解釋說:“剩下的選擇就是使用具有嵌入式軟內核或外部微控制器的FPGA,但採用基於FPGA解決方案的問題是,與整合式SoC相比,FPGA解決方案的性能較差、占位面積較大,且功耗高出44倍。此外,在FPGA中實現的‘秘方’很容易被竊取,所以在許多情況下,這都不是一個可行的選擇。無晶圓廠半導體公司無法利用FPGA解決方案把產品帶入市場。”) y, i6 i/ Q# _9 i# h
# K( p: N( @7 U# n, T2 M1 ]! ^Johnson最後表示:“對於無晶圓廠半導體公司而言,最具成本效益的高性能選擇是CAP7L可客製化微控制器。該產品提供了成本低廉的小批量解決方案,具有客製化SoC的功耗、性能和IP安全性特性,而且沒有額外的授權費用或昂貴的單位成本。CAP7L在最差情形下的功耗在3mW和4mW之間,較典型 FPGA的功耗降低98%。”; ^& L1 i' g: R$ b4 _, B* s) w
7 r: a- |( [' H2 x0 _% C# ?3 e; s
設計流程 " E4 O% b9 r; z8 a# l) H
- CAP7L的設計流程與 “FPGA加MCU”或ASIC實施方案相同,最初使用 Altera®或 Xilinx® FPGA和一個基於ARM7處理器的MCU來進行開發,愛特梅爾提供具有直接FPGA介面、基於ARM7處理器的CAP7E MCU。CAP7E之上的介面將FPGA與CAP7L上的AMBA AHB和周邊DMA控制器直接相連。此外,愛特梅爾還提供FPGA邏輯,對FPGA和CAP7E微控制器之間流動的匯流排通信量進行解碼和編碼。FPGA中的邏輯模組經由AMBA AH主和從通道連接至CAP7E MCU。在移植到CAP7L之前,設計人員可以使用“CAP7E加 FPGA”實施方案進行早期市場的測試和概念的驗證。- x v: G+ D1 u) X0 T
3 K& M% c- w, v7 B R5 P. F, @2 k除了提供ARM內核,愛特梅爾還備有一個大型的IP軟體庫,它不需要授權費用和權益金,並已在CAP7L MP模組中經過全面的驗證和測試。愛特梅爾的免費IP包括支援RS232、RS485、ISO7816和IRDA的USART、IRDA、一個串列同步控制器(SSC)、I2S、音頻AC’97控制器、雙線介面(主及從)、串列周邊介面(SPI)、SD卡/MMC卡主控制器、控制器區域網路2.0B + 8 個郵箱、並行 I/O (32)、定時計數器、脈寬調變(PWM)、資料加密標準(TDES-133 MHz)、先進加密標準 (AES-128/196/256)、安全散列演算法(secure hash algorithm, SHA1)、AHB/APB 橋、外部匯流排界面、外部靜態 RAM / 快閃記憶體控制器、可用於NAND快閃記憶體的錯誤糾正控制器 (error correction controller, ECC)、SDARM控制器和ZBT RAM控制器。% A. ^2 s2 c# v; t, b
k$ J& d! A5 x$ E# J* L, p可用於任何客製化IP的HDL代碼是使用標準的特定供應商或第三方FPGA設計工具而開發的,一旦經過驗證,客戶必需將暫存器傳輸級(RTL) 網表 (netlist)提供給愛特梅爾,以便在CAP7L的MP模組中實施。
# u$ V. W" {; b6 `0 @; w. N4 e7 p ~7 Z7 N
最終的閘級網表原型可在10周內提供;生產批量網表則在12周內提供。
. Q7 i2 Y! [2 Y5 L+ B
! X, k$ z2 l9 n' |# ?/ q, F現有的第三方工具 - 愛特梅爾基於ARM處理器的MCU系列所用的 C編譯器、RTOS、OS、ICE和IDE也可與這些器件的CAP版共用,其中包括愛特梅爾的免費GNU gcc C編譯器、GNU gdb 除錯器、FreeRTOS.org即時內核,商用工具包括ARM (RealView Development Suite, RealView ICE, RealView Trace2) Green Hills® (Multi® IDE、 TimeMachine™、Integrity® OS)、IAR™ (C 編譯器 – Embedded Workbench)、ExpressLogic (即時作業系統 – ThreadX®) 和Micrium (即時作業系統 – uCOS/II)。5 V& x# |+ p; K6 z1 Z) P) V/ G- {
( D/ C' s7 ^/ n2 A9 a6 p供貨和價格 - 愛特梅爾現可提供CAP7L可客製化微控制器,NRE費用為7.5萬美元,採用144 LQFP
& W' K+ ?0 S6 S C M封裝,訂購 5萬個器件的單價為5.50美元。7.5萬美元 NRE成本包括協助客戶將其FPGA代碼重新瞄準 (re-targeting) 進入愛特梅爾金屬可程式庫的設計工程技術、靜態定時分析和收斂、佈局佈線、設計修整、光罩和10個快速交貨的原型。此外,愛特梅爾還提供一組低成本的入門級工具套件,可用於工程技術評測。AT91CAP7A-STK工具套件的價格為399美元。
0 y: U! Q$ R1 r' U1 c$ \ l
7 P* F$ y- y# ?* N/ p* [9 Q同時,內建FPGA介面的CAP7E微控制器也在供應中,訂購一萬片,單價為9.50美元。
7 {: x7 P6 |. n" q& j' m3 ~) r) L% l1 I8 l7 ]- w1 H. b
[ 本帖最後由 heavy91 於 2009-4-28 03:06 PM 編輯 ] |
|